Transaction 2a13164e393574fdeb263c55009017c5683f1d74ca147cab2f862c310645b053
1 Input
1 Output
-
2a13164e393574fdeb263c55009017c5683f1d74ca147cab2f862c310645b053:0
- value
- 25592130
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4842fc6484382561c09d679e437054e6fa1ed1db OP_EQUAL
- address
- 38H6pcoUMfNyRKDT63KiriAmPYtVkLSQeT